Active acoustic sites sampled within the NPS National Capital Region units in 2017. Locations were repeats of Gates and Johnson (2005). 2005). Sites were sampled for 20 minute periods. Absence (A) and presence (P) were based on Kaleidoscope Bats of North America 4.2.0 classifier MLE < 0.05. Sample periods were 20 minutes in duration. Samples where there were no rain events are indicated with 1. Species abbreviations include: big brown (Eptesicus fuscus; EPFU), eastern red (Lasiurus borealis; LABO), hoary bat (Lasiurus cinereus; LACI), silver-haired (Lasionycteris noctivagans; LANO), eastern small-footed (Myotis leibii; MYLE), little brown (Myotis lucifugus; MYLU), northern long-eared (Myotis septentrionalis; MYSE), Indiana (Myotis sodalis; MYSO), evening (Nycticeius humeralis; NYHU), and tri-colored bat (Perimyotis subflavus; PESU).
